EXCLUSIVE: Angel Brinks Sues Insurance Company Over Reality Show Shoot, NOT Mona Scott-Young According To Sources
theJasmineBRAND exclusively reports, TV personality and fashion entrepreneur Angel Brinks is NOT taking legal action against Mona Scott-Young. This week, reports circulated claiming that the former “Basketball Wives” star was suing Mona Scott-Young’s production company over alleged damage done to her property during filming.
An incident is said to have happened last year during the filming of a television show at her Angel Brinks headquarters. Mona Scott-Young was shooting footage for a potential reality show with Brinks for WE tv, when Brinks’ business suffered severe water damage after a sprinkler was broken and sprayed some of her property.
While the incident did happen, sources tell us that Brinks is NOT suing Scott-Young. A source tells us:
“This is strictly a claim with the insurance company NOT Monami [Scott Young’s business) and there is absolutely NO contention or acrimony between Mona and Angel.”
The source continues:
“saying negative things about Monami and their efforts when this happened is FALSE. Angel and Mona are colleagues and friends. They do not have any issues over this unfortunate accident.”
We’re told that there’s no bad blood between the pair and are still good friends. No additional details about Brinks’ lawsuit against the insurance company have been released.
